Wash. Admin. Code § 357-52-035 - What happens if the appellant does not submit all the information required by WAC 357-52-020?
(1)
When the board receives an appeal, it reviews the document(s) to determine
whether the information required by this section has been provided.
(2) If any of the required information is not
provided with the appeal, the board directs the appellant to provide the
missing information and sends a copy of the notice to all affected
parties.
(3) The appellant must
provide the missing information as requested within twenty-one calendar days of
the date the notification is mailed.
(4) When the board receives the requested
information, it sends a copy to the other affected parties.
(5) If the appellant fails to comply with the
requirements of this section the board may dismiss the appeal according to WAC
357-52-215.
